アカウント名:
パスワード:
1837830 - Native messaging manifests no longer allow relative paths contaning a `..` componenthttps://bugzilla.mozilla.org/show_bug.cgi?id=1837830 [mozilla.org]
自分で決めた仕様のテストパターン入れてなかったかぁ。
しかも(起票が昨日なので)明らかにベータでテストしてないという。
自分で決めたのかな?
最近のFirefoxのアドオン [mozilla.org]ってChromeの [chrome.com]をベースにすこし拡張してる程度だから、仕様を決めてるのはほとんどChromeなんだよね。
もちろん互換にすることを決めたのはFirefoxなんだから、テストしてない言い訳にはならないけど。Chromeのソースにあるテストとか流用してないのかな?
なんだよ、Firefoxが原因なんか
ただアプリ側での回避が可能なので(絶対パスで指定すればいい)、Firefox側の修正を待たずにマイナポータルアプリの更新で対応する可能性がある
それすると、ESR版で動かなくならない?
絶対パスで指定すれば修正の有無にかかわらず動くので問題ない。そもそもWindows版以外は絶対パスしかサポートしていない(今回Windows版のみが影響を受けたのもそのためだろう)。
絶対パスを使うように仕様が変わったのではなく、もともと絶対パスも相対パスも(Windows版では)使えたけど、Firefox 114で相対パスの処理にバグがあったというだけ。だからESR版でも問題ない
115.0beta6で修正された。Win7~8.1ではESR115を使い続けることになるので、(いつものようにWONTFIXで)先送りされなくてよかった。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
計算機科学者とは、壊れていないものを修理する人々のことである
Bbugzilla (スコア:2, 参考になる)
1837830 - Native messaging manifests no longer allow relative paths contaning a `..` component
https://bugzilla.mozilla.org/show_bug.cgi?id=1837830 [mozilla.org]
Re: (スコア:0)
自分で決めた仕様のテストパターン入れてなかったかぁ。
Re: (スコア:0)
しかも(起票が昨日なので)明らかにベータでテストしてないという。
Re: (スコア:0)
自分で決めたのかな?
最近のFirefoxのアドオン [mozilla.org]ってChromeの [chrome.com]をベースにすこし拡張してる程度だから、仕様を決めてるのはほとんどChromeなんだよね。
もちろん互換にすることを決めたのはFirefoxなんだから、テストしてない言い訳にはならないけど。
Chromeのソースにあるテストとか流用してないのかな?
Re: (スコア:0)
なんだよ、Firefoxが原因なんか
Re: (スコア:0)
ただアプリ側での回避が可能なので(絶対パスで指定すればいい)、Firefox側の修正を待たずにマイナポータルアプリの更新で対応する可能性がある
Re: (スコア:0)
それすると、ESR版で動かなくならない?
Re: (スコア:0)
絶対パスで指定すれば修正の有無にかかわらず動くので問題ない。そもそもWindows版以外は絶対パスしかサポートしていない(今回Windows版のみが影響を受けたのもそのためだろう)。
Re: (スコア:0)
絶対パスを使うように仕様が変わったのではなく、もともと絶対パスも相対パスも(Windows版では)使えたけど、Firefox 114で相対パスの処理にバグがあったというだけ。だからESR版でも問題ない
Re:Bugzilla (スコア:0)
115.0beta6で修正された。
Win7~8.1ではESR115を使い続けることになるので、(いつものようにWONTFIXで)先送りされなくてよかった。